The chapters in this volume evolved from oral presentations given at the
13th West Virginia University Conference on Life-Span Developmental Psychology.
Consistent with preceding volumes in this series, the contributors represent a
variety of disciplines related to the theme of the conference and the ensuing
volume. In this instance, the theme is biological and neuropsychological
mechanisms in lifespan psychological development and the disciplines
represented are behavioural medicine, neurology, neuropsychology,
psychophysiology and psychology. The theme is expressed in theories and
findings about genetic and environmental mechanisms; brain mechanisms;
relations of physiological functioning in infancy to later development;
physiological risk factors in infancy, adolescence and old age; methodological
and data analytic problems; and issues about the validity of neuropsychological
assessment. This volume starts with overviews of theoretical and methodological
issues and continues with chapters dealing with selected portions of the life
